profiles: Add bearer field to btd_profile
Add bearer filed into btd_profile to indicates which bearer
type this profile belongs to. Thus we can distinct the services
per bearer.

bearer: Implement Connect/Disconnect methods
This patch provides implementations for the Connect and Disconnect
methods of the org.bluez.Bearer.LE1 and org.bluez.Bearer.BREDR1
interfaces.
